The 16 m² Quigley Buildings - Stylish Entire 2 Bed House Sleeps 5 Wigan - Private Garden - Free Parking - Wifi - Secure Garden Apartment features views of the garden and is situated about a 10-minute ride from Orrell Water Park.
Location
St Pauls Church is only a 14-minute walk away. You can also reach Wigan Pier, which is nearly a 10-minute ride away.
Billinge Road/The Spinney bus stop is within arm's reach of the apartment.
Rooms
Along with climate control, Quigley Buildings - Stylish Entire 2 Bed House Sleeps 5 Wigan - Private Garden - Free Parking - Wifi - Secure Garden Apartment is also equipped with a flat-screen TV with satellite channels for a more enjoyable stay. A highlight of the accommodation for guests is the presence of hairdryers in the bathroom. Additionally, you'll find a tub.
Eat & Drink
This 2-bedroom apartment has a fully-fitted kitchen including a microwave, an electric kettle, and a fridge. The restaurant Munchies is located about a 10-minute ride from the property.
